Installation Tips for Budget-Friendly Battery Trays
Before embarking on the installation of an affordable battery tray, it’s crucial to ensure you have the necessary tools and safety equipment. Gather a socket set, wrenches, pliers, safety glasses, and gloves. Disconnecting the negative terminal of the battery is paramount before proceeding to prevent accidental electrical shorts. Remember to work in a well-ventilated area, as batteries can release harmful gases.
When selecting a battery tray under $20, fit is essential. Carefully measure the dimensions of your battery and compare them to the internal dimensions of the tray. A snug fit will minimize movement, but avoid forcing the battery into a tray that is too small. Consider the mounting style of the tray – some attach with straps, others with bolts – and choose one that is compatible with your vehicle’s existing mounting points.
Properly preparing the mounting surface is crucial for a secure installation. Clean any dirt, rust, or debris from the area where the tray will be installed. If necessary, use a wire brush or sandpaper to remove stubborn rust. Applying a coat of rust-resistant primer to the mounting surface can further enhance the longevity of the installation. Ensure the surface is dry and free of contaminants before proceeding.
Once the mounting surface is prepared, carefully position the battery tray and secure it using the appropriate hardware. If the tray comes with straps, ensure they are tightened evenly to prevent the battery from shifting. If bolts are used, avoid overtightening them, as this can damage the tray or the mounting surface. After installation, double-check that the battery is securely held in place and that there are no loose connections or obstructions.
Materials Used in Affordable Car Battery Trays
Cost-effective car battery trays often utilize a limited range of materials to keep production costs down. Polypropylene plastic is a common choice due to its low cost, lightweight nature, and resistance to battery acid. However, it’s important to note that polypropylene can become brittle over time, especially when exposed to extreme temperatures or UV radiation. This can lead to cracking and eventual failure of the tray.
Another material frequently used is stamped steel. Steel trays offer greater strength and durability compared to plastic options. They are typically coated with a corrosion-resistant finish, such as powder coating or galvanization, to protect against rust and acid exposure. However, even with these coatings, steel trays can be susceptible to corrosion over time, particularly in environments with high humidity or exposure to road salt.
The quality of the coating applied to steel trays is a critical factor in their longevity. Powder coating generally provides superior protection compared to spray-on coatings, as it creates a thicker and more uniform layer. Galvanization, which involves coating the steel with a layer of zinc, is another effective method of rust prevention. When selecting a steel battery tray, look for one with a high-quality coating that is resistant to chipping and peeling.
While less common in budget-friendly options, some trays may incorporate rubber or foam padding to provide additional shock absorption and protection for the battery. This padding can help to minimize vibrations and reduce the risk of damage to the battery casing. If you are concerned about vibration, consider adding your own padding to the tray, such as a piece of rubber sheeting or foam insulation.
Maintenance Tips for Under $20 Car Battery Trays
Maintaining your affordable car battery tray is crucial for prolonging its lifespan and ensuring continued protection for your battery. Regular cleaning is essential, especially after exposure to spills, road salt, or other contaminants. Use a mild detergent and water solution to wipe down the tray, removing any dirt or debris that may accumulate. Avoid using harsh chemicals or abrasive cleaners, as these can damage the tray’s finish or material.
Inspect the tray regularly for signs of corrosion or damage. Pay close attention to areas around the mounting points and edges, as these are often the most vulnerable to rust. If you notice any signs of corrosion, clean the affected area and apply a rust-resistant primer or paint. Address any cracks or breaks in the tray immediately, as these can compromise its ability to securely hold the battery.
For plastic trays, consider applying a UV protectant spray to help prevent the plastic from becoming brittle and cracking over time. This is particularly important if the tray is exposed to direct sunlight for extended periods. These protectants can help maintain the flexibility and integrity of the plastic, extending the tray’s lifespan.
Periodically check the tightness of the battery tray’s mounting hardware. Vibration and constant movement can cause bolts or straps to loosen over time. Tighten any loose hardware to ensure the battery remains securely held in place. If the hardware is corroded or damaged, replace it with new stainless-steel hardware to prevent future problems. By implementing these simple maintenance practices, you can maximize the lifespan of your affordable car battery tray and ensure it continues to provide reliable protection for your battery.

2. Size and Compatibility
Ensuring the battery tray’s dimensions are compatible with your vehicle’s battery and mounting location is a fundamental consideration. A tray that is too small will not securely hold the battery, leading to vibration and potential damage. Conversely, an oversized tray may not fit within the designated space in the engine compartment, hindering its installation. Battery sizes are typically categorized by Battery Council International (BCI) group numbers, which define the physical dimensions and terminal placement. It’s crucial to consult your vehicle’s owner’s manual or a battery fitment guide to determine the correct BCI group size for your battery.
Furthermore, the tray’s mounting style must be compatible with your vehicle’s chassis. Some trays are designed for direct bolting to the frame, while others utilize straps or clamps for securing the battery. Misalignment between the tray’s mounting points and the vehicle’s frame can lead to installation difficulties and compromise the battery’s stability. Statistical analysis of customer reviews for the best car battery trays under $20 reveals that size and compatibility issues are a frequent source of dissatisfaction. Accurate measurement and cross-referencing with your vehicle’s specifications are essential to avoid such problems.

5. Ventilation and Drainage
Adequate ventilation and drainage are crucial for preventing the accumulation of corrosive gases and liquids around the battery. Battery acid spillage, while relatively infrequent, can cause significant damage to surrounding components if not properly contained and neutralized. Ventilation allows for the dissipation of hydrogen gas, which is produced during the charging process. Poor ventilation can lead to a buildup of hydrogen gas, creating a potentially explosive environment.
Drainage holes in the battery tray facilitate the removal of spilled acid and condensation, preventing corrosion of the tray and surrounding metal parts. The size and placement of these drainage holes are critical to their effectiveness. Small or poorly positioned holes can become clogged with debris, hindering their ability to drain liquids effectively. Empirical data demonstrates that battery trays with integrated drainage systems experience significantly less corrosion over time compared to trays without such features. Therefore, when evaluating the best car battery trays under $20, prioritize models with adequate ventilation and strategically placed drainage holes to minimize the risk of corrosion and acid damage.

What materials are common in car battery trays, and which ones are most resistant to corrosion?
Car battery trays are commonly made from plastic (polypropylene or similar) or metal (steel or aluminum). Plastic trays offer excellent resistance to battery acid and are generally more lightweight, but might be less robust against physical impact. Metal trays, especially those constructed from steel, provide superior strength and durability but are susceptible to corrosion if not properly coated.
The best metal battery trays typically feature a powder coating or a similar protective layer that prevents the metal from coming into direct contact with battery acid and moisture. When choosing a metal tray, look for indications of corrosion resistance, such as a durable paint finish or a galvanized coating. Plastic trays eliminate the risk of rust entirely, making them a good option in areas with high humidity or frequent exposure to corrosive elements.
